UoT Scholars to Conduct Research at Prestigious Global Institutions

Turbat: Two researchers from the University of Turbat (UoT) have been awarded scholarships under the Higher Education Commission’s International Research Support Initiative Program, enabling them to conduct research at leading foreign universities for six months.

Mr. Wajid Ali, a lecturer in the Department of Natural and Basic Sciences at UoT, has been selected to work under the guidance of Dr. Vincent Noireaux at the University of Minnesota in the United States. His research will also be supervised by Dr. Hanif-ur-Rehman, an associate professor at UoT.

In parallel, Mr. Mir Chakar Rahim, a PhD scholar at the university, will conduct his research at Imperial College London in the United Kingdom. His work will be overseen by Dr. Rodrigo Ledesma-Amaro, along with Dr. Hanif-ur-Rehman serving as his internal supervisor.
